Theresa Magdelina Schroeder (Kruchten) died on Saturday, May 29, 2021, at her home. She was born on March 23, 1930, on a farm in the town of Berry, near Cross Plains, Wis., to Mary (Maier) and Joseph Kruchten. Her mother died when she was young, and she helped her beloved sister Ann take on the household duties. She was united in marriage to Henry "Hank" J. Schroeder on May 5, 1949. Theresa and Hank ran/managed the family farm and successfully raised 8 children.
Theresa taught herself to sew at a young age, a passion that followed her through her adult life making beautiful clothes for her family and friends. She made her own wedding dress as well as most of the dresses for her children's weddings. She was an intelligent woman and to prove it at the age of 60 went back to school to get her GED. She was a long-time member of the "Elm Neighborhood Homemakers" club where she enjoyed spending time with the neighborhood women.
